CVE-2024-57887
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: drm: adv7511: Fix use-after-free in adv7533attachdsi The hostnode pointer was assigned and freed in adv7533parsedt, and later, adv7533attachdsi uses the same. Fix this use-after-free issue by dropping ofnodeput in adv7533parsedt...
